Tour de France: Romain Bardet “a little disappointed” after just one day in yellow

Romain Bardet’s adventure in yellow on the Tour only lasted one day. “It was a special experience,” savoured the Auvergne climber, inevitably “a little disappointed” to give up his beautiful jersey to Tadej Pogacar, already in command on this Tour.

Only 22nd in the stage, this Sunday in Bologna, 21” from Tadej Pogacar, 14th at the finish, Romain Bardet lost his beautiful tunic. A yellow jersey that the Slovenian will wear on Monday on the 3rd stage for six short seconds.

The Yellow Jersey gave way on the second climb of the San Luca hill, a formidable wall (10.6% on average, over almost 2 kilometers), placed in the final.

Slightly unhooked after the work of the team-mates of the big leaders, Romain Bardet was unable to respond to the lightning attack of Tadej Pogacar (UAE) in sight of the summit of San Luca, 13 kilometers from the finish.

“A special experience”

“It was a really great day and riding with the yellow jersey was a really special experience,” said the Auvergne climber. “At the time, I’m a little disappointed to have lost it of course, especially by a few seconds, but I tried to give it my all and the team did a really good job supporting me all day.”

“I am very happy that there are two French victories already,” he added, waiting to be able to seize a new opportunity to show himself at the forefront.
